Output ecfc07de7dafcfa32c4c8950b16d0194598601b5fe2bb1d8eede599bca350549:77

value
98992
script pubkey
OP_0 OP_PUSHBYTES_20 cb02bbdf18515bc7bfd08a84b9e25067418715ba
address
bc1qevpthhcc29du007s32ztncjsvaqcw9d62s0c87
transaction
ecfc07de7dafcfa32c4c8950b16d0194598601b5fe2bb1d8eede599bca350549
spent
true